Ever since 2003 when Mars made its closest approach to Earth in 60,000 years and loomed large in the sky with its glorious red shine, every August our email boxes fill with well-meaning messages from friends determined to inform us of this spectacular event.  While technically not a hoax, this has become more of an urban legend.  
NASA sets the record straight once again.   There are lots of exciting things in the sky, including a conjunction of Venus and Mars, but this isn’t one of them.
